Report Highlight and Description
  • According to the latest report by IMARC Group,
    titled "United States Data Center Colocation
    Market Industry Trends, Share, Size, Growth,
    Opportunity and Forecast 2024-2032," the United
    States data center colocation market size is
    projected to exhibit a growth rate (CAGR) of
    6.80 during 2024-2032.
  • The United States data center colocation market
    is witnessing robust growth, driven by a surge in
    demand for scalable, cost-effective, and reliable
    IT infrastructure. One of the primary factors
    propelling this market is the rapid digital
    transformation across various industries. As
    businesses increasingly adopt cloud computing,
    big data analytics, and Internet of Things (IoT)
    technologies, the need for expansive and
    sophisticated data storage and processing
    capabilities has grown. Colocation facilities
    provide an ideal solution, offering businesses
    the flexibility to expand their IT operations
    without the significant capital expenditures
    associated with building and maintaining their
    data centers. This trend is particularly
    prominent among small and medium-sized
    enterprises (SMEs) that may lack the resources to
    develop and manage in-house data centers but
    require high-performance infrastructure to
    compete in the digital economy. Additionally, the
    rise in hybrid IT strategies, where companies
    blend on-premises, colocation, and cloud
    resources, is further fueling the demand for
    colocation services as organizations seek to
    optimize their IT environments for cost,
    performance, and security.

Report Description
  • United States Data Center Colocation Market
    Trends
  • Another significant factor driving the U.S. data
    center colocation market is the growing emphasis
    on data security and compliance. With increasing
    concerns over data breaches, cyber-attacks, and
    stringent regulatory requirements, companies are
    turning to colocation providers who can offer
    enhanced physical security measures and robust
    data protection protocols. Colocation facilities
    often feature advanced security systems,
    including biometric access controls, 24/7
    surveillance, and redundant power and cooling
    systems, which are critical for ensuring data
    integrity and uptime. Moreover, colocation
    providers are increasingly offering compliance
    certifications, such as SOC 2, HIPAA, and
    PCI-DSS, which are essential for businesses in
    highly regulated industries like healthcare,
    finance, and e-commerce. This ability to meet
    rigorous compliance standards without the need
    for internal resources is a significant draw for
    companies looking to safeguard sensitive data
    while focusing on their core business operations.
    In addition to security and compliance, the need
    for low-latency connectivity is driving the
    adoption of colocation services. With the rise of
    edge computing, where data processing occurs
    closer to the data source to reduce latency,
    businesses are seeking colocation facilities that
    are strategically located near major population
    centers and network hubs. This proximity enables
    faster data transfer speeds and improved user
    experiences, particularly for applications
    requiring real-time processing, such as online
    gaming, financial trading, and autonomous
    vehicles.
